RIS-MISO-DRL

DRL-based RIS Configuration in RIS-assisted MU-MISO mmWave Systems for Min-Max MSE Optimization under HWI of Phase errors, Phase-dependent amplitude response model, and Imperfect CSI

Installing

  • Install Anaconda
  • Import the environment (though the YAML string-based config will be deprecated in the future)
    conda env create --file sb3.yaml --name sb3
